The wrong POS system can hurt your profits
and alienate customers. Here are some tips to increase your chances
of success with POS selection:
1. Insufficient planning is the number one mistake. Create a detailed
action plan to select and install your system. Identify all the POS
functions that your operation needs. Check our site for the POS
features list that you can use as a guide.
2. Is the POS system designed for your industry?
3. Does the POS provider serve customers that are the same size
as your operation?
4. How easy is the POS system to use for your employees?
5. How compatible is the POS system with any systems you already
have or plan to buy?
6. How compatible is the POS system with your home office systems?
7. Can the system grow if you increase the number of locations?
8. Can the system be upgraded as new features are released?
9. Check system performance in the field for transaction and processing
speed.
10. Analyze firewall, encryption and security risks, especially if
the system is web-based or an ASP.
11. In addition to vendor costs, factor in on-going maintenance.
12. Does the support organization have a can do attitude
and a 24/7 help desk?
13. Evaluate the training offerings and confirm your supplier can
serve your location and your type of staff.
14. Call accounts that already have the system and see how satisfied
they are.
